Merchants are non-playable characters that usually operate a store and may buy and/or sell items in exchange for gold pieces. Often they can identify magical items, in most cases for a fixed rate of 100gp. Temple priests who also offer potions or scrolls can also count as merchants, as well as some inn- and bar-keepers.

The best merchant to sell your stuff to in BG2:SoA is Ribald using his special stock, which only becomes available in Chapter 6. He'll buy your items at 55% of their value. Another notable merchant is Priestess of Sekolah, available near the end of Chapter 4 who'll buy your items at 50% of their value which should give you enough money to buy useful items in Chapter 5.

The best merchant to sell to in ToB is Karthis al-Hezzar who is available after the player is able to leave Saradush. He'll buy your items at the rate of 60%.
